Transaction 1dbec38cda7e7123c82dde17aa674afbe3cc0381641cdcfec57a86c642cc4163
1 Input
1 Output
-
1dbec38cda7e7123c82dde17aa674afbe3cc0381641cdcfec57a86c642cc4163:0
- value
- 825828
- script pubkey
- OP_0 OP_PUSHBYTES_20 3506bc14262f783c831c2ccb1fa2a80bb5f6a715
- address
- bc1qx5rtc9px9aureqcu9n93lg4gpw6ldfc434rr2l